A fermentation product created by bacteria Lactobacillus. The fermented product has anti-bacterial properties and might be helpful in calming down inflammation, but studies are lacking. Helps attract water to the upper layer of the skin. Can be used as a preservative

Ingredient list view
Water, Glycerin, Propanediol, Lactobacillus ferment, Maltooligosyl glucoside, Caprylyl/capryl glucoside, Hydrogenated starch hydrolysate, Rosa damascena flower extract, Avena sativa leaf/stalk extract, Saccharide isomerate, Polyglyceryl-3 cocoate, Polyglyceryl-10 laurate, Levulinic acid, Citric acid, Sodium citrate
